Output d64abb118e5cf6dee43c6166ef8988c586670781e2744ba011b7542106ee4ef3:79

value
1823053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d626f580e1baecca3a7d44a451f1fc77c6081a61 OP_EQUAL
address
3MDMCWmeT4z1VWoeLymyfVvuFdnauqPpKo
transaction
d64abb118e5cf6dee43c6166ef8988c586670781e2744ba011b7542106ee4ef3
spent
true